Job Title:School-Based Therapist
We are looking for a School-Based Therapist to join our team. This role plays a vital part in promoting the mental emotional and behavioral well-being of our diverse student population ensuring they have the support needed to succeed in a rigorous and inclusive academic environment. The therapist will provide direct mental health services including individual and group counseling crisis intervention and family engagement. In this collaborative role the therapist will work closely with educators administrators and families to implement trauma-informed and culturally responsive interventions aligned with the schools mission and values.
What you bring to the table
Masters Degree in Social Work Counseling Psychology or a related field
Current Pennsylvania licensure (e.g. LCSW LPC LMFT) or working toward licensure under clinical supervision
Strong knowledge of child and adolescent development mental health assessment and evidence-based therapeutic practices
Experience developing and implementing individualized treatment plans and therapeutic interventions for students
Skill in using trauma-informed culturally responsive and strengths-based approaches to support student wellness
Excellent oral and written communication skills for collaborating with families staff and community partners
Ability to build trust and rapport with students families and staff to foster a safe and supportive school environment
Commitment to diversity equity and inclusion in school-based mental health services
Bilingual in Spanish preferred
